Asbestos inspection services involve thorough assessments to identify the presence of asbestos-containing materials within a property. These inspections typically include visual examinations of accessible areas and may involve sampling suspect materials for laboratory analysis. The goal is to determine whether asbestos is present, its condition, and the potential risk it may pose. Property owners often seek these services before renovation, demolition, or purchase to ensure safety and compliance with regulations.
The primary purpose of asbestos inspections is to help property owners and managers address potential health hazards associated with asbestos exposure. Asbestos fibers, when disturbed or deteriorated, can become airborne and pose serious health risks, including respiratory issues and certain cancers. Identifying asbestos early allows for proper management, such as encapsulation or removal, reducing the risk of exposure during ongoing use or renovations. Inspections also assist in avoiding costly surprises during construction projects by clarifying the presence and condition of asbestos materials beforehand.
Properties that typically utilize asbestos inspection services include residential buildings, commercial complexes, industrial facilities, and public institutions. Older homes, especially those built before the 1980s, are common candidates due to the widespread use of asbestos in insulation, flooring, roofing, and other building materials during that period. Commercial and industrial properties may also require inspections to ensure safe conditions for occupants and workers, particularly when planning upgrades or renovations. Schools, hospitals, and government buildings often seek inspections to adhere to safety standards and regulations.

Inspection Costs - The price for asbestos inspection services typically ranges from $300 to $800, depending on the property's size and complexity. For example, a standard residential inspection in Livingston, NJ, might cost around $400. Larger or more detailed assessments can reach closer to $1,000.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for asbestos inspections often fall between $50 and $150 per hour, with total costs influenced by the number of areas to be tested. A basic inspection of a small home may require 2-3 hours, resulting in a fee of approximately $200 to $450.
Sample Collection Expenses - The cost for sample collection generally ranges from $100 to $300 per sample, depending on accessibility and the number of samples needed. A typical inspection might involve 3-5 samples, totaling about $300 to $1,500.
Testing and Analysis Fees - Laboratory analysis of asbestos samples usually costs between $150 and $400 per sample, with bulk testing discounts sometimes available. An inspection with multiple samples could total $600 to $2,000 for comprehensive testing services.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
